To effectively deter squirrels from inhabiting trees, implement a multi-pronged approach. Firstly, remove potential nesting sites by trimming or removing excess branches, particularly those close to buildings or other structures. Secondly, eliminate food sources by securely storing birdseed and other squirrel-attracting items indoors. Lastly, consider physical barriers such as metal flashing around tree trunks or motion-activated sprinklers to discourage access.
